编程离线状态是什么

不及物动词 其他 16

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    离线状态是指计算机、手机等电子设备在没有连接到互联网或网络的情况下的工作状态。在离线状态下,设备无法访问网络资源,例如浏览网页、发送电子邮件、收发信息等。编程离线状态指的是在进行编程活动时,设备没有连接到网络的情况。

    编程离线状态的工作环境通常是一个本地开发环境,也称为离线开发环境。在这种环境下,开发者可以编写、测试和运行代码,而无需依赖于互联网。离线开发环境通常包括以下几个组件:

    1. 编辑器:离线编程通常使用本地安装的代码编辑器,例如Visual Studio Code、Sublime Text、Atom等。这些编辑器提供了代码高亮、语法检查、自动补全等功能,方便开发者进行代码编写。

    2. 编译器/解释器:离线编程需要本地安装编程语言的编译器或解释器,以便将代码转换成机器语言或解释执行代码。例如,Python需要安装Python解释器,C语言需要使用GCC编译器等。

    3. 调试器:离线开发环境通常提供调试功能,方便开发者在本地环境中调试代码。调试器可以帮助开发者找到代码中的错误,进行断点调试,观察变量的值等。

    4. 版本控制系统:离线开发环境中通常会使用版本控制系统,例如Git,来管理代码的版本和协作开发。版本控制系统可以帮助开发者记录代码的修改历史,方便回滚、合并代码等操作。

    5. 测试工具:离线开发环境通常会包含各种测试工具,例如单元测试框架、性能测试工具等,用于验证代码的正确性和性能。

    在离线状态下进行编程有以下几个优点:

    1. 灵活性:离线编程可以在没有互联网连接的情况下进行,让开发者可以随时随地进行编程工作,不受网络条件的限制。

    2. 隐私保护:有些项目的代码可能涉及商业机密或敏感信息,因此离线编程可以提供更高的数据安全性和隐私保护。

    3. 性能提升:离线编程可以避免网络延迟和网络环境不稳定的影响,提高代码执行的速度和性能。

    当然,离线编程也存在一些限制和挑战:

    1. 缺乏在线资源和社区支持:离线编程无法及时访问互联网上的文档、教程、论坛等资源,开发者可能需要提前下载或收集一些离线资源。

    2. 无法进行在线协作:离线编程无法与其他开发者实时进行协作,无法享受到在线编程平台和工具提供的协作功能。

    3. 版本控制和项目管理的挑战:离线编程需要更加小心地管理代码的版本和项目的进展,减少因为不同版本的代码出现冲突和丢失的风险。

    总体而言,离线编程是一种弹性高、安全性较强的编程方式,开发者可以根据自身需求和项目要求选择在线还是离线的开发环境。无论是离线编程还是在线编程,都是为了实现计算机程序的设计、开发和测试,以达到预期的功能和效果。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程离线状态是指在没有网络连接的情况下进行编程工作或访问已经下载到本地的代码库和开发工具的状态。在离线状态下,程序员无法通过互联网访问在线资源,如代码库、文档、教程、工具等。编程离线状态下的工作通常需要提前下载所需的工具和资源,并在没有网络连接的时候进行。

    以下是关于编程离线状态的一些重要点:

    1. 工作环境:在离线状态下,程序员需要配置一个合适的工作环境来完成编程任务。这包括安装所需的开发工具、编译器和相应的依赖项。确保所有必备的软件和库已经下载并正确安装是离线编程的重要一环。

    2. 存储和备份:离线编程需要充足的存储空间来存储所需的代码、文件和资源。程序员应该确保本地存储设备有足够的空间来存储所有必备的工具和资源。此外,定期进行备份是至关重要的,以防止数据丢失。

    3. 离线调试和测试:在离线状态下,程序员需要确保他们能够进行调试和测试他们的代码。为此,他们需要在离线状态下配置适当的调试环境,并使用本地模拟器或虚拟机进行测试。如果需要外部设备或传感器,他们可能需要提前准备这些设备并连接到本地计算机。

    4. 文档和资源:在离线状态下,程序员无法访问在线的编程资源、文档、教程和帮助文档。因此,他们需要提前下载所需的文档和资源,并建立一个本地的文档库。这样可以保证他们在离线状态下也能够查找和参考所需的文档。

    5. 版本控制和团队合作:离线状态下,程序员可能无法使用在线的版本控制系统,如Git,来与团队成员进行合作。在这种情况下,程序员应该使用本地的版本控制工具,并确保代码的更改和更新能够与团队成员分享和同步。

    总而言之,编程离线状态需要提前准备并配置合适的工作环境,确保所需的工具、资源和文档已经下载到本地。这样可以确保程序员能够在没有网络连接的情况下进行编程工作,并完成各种调试、测试和版本控制任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程离线状态指的是在没有网络连接的情况下进行编程工作。在离线状态下,程序员无法访问互联网上的资源、工具和库。然而,即使没有网络连接,程序员仍然可以进行一些开发工作,如编写代码、运行本地测试等。本文将从方法、操作流程等方面,介绍编程离线状态下的工作方式。

    一、准备离线工具和资源

    1. 安装开发环境和工具:在离线状态下编程,需要先安装相应的开发环境和工具。例如,安装合适的代码编辑器(如Visual Studio Code、Sublime Text等)、编程语言环境(如Python、Java等)、版本控制系统(如Git)等。
    2. 下载离线文档和参考资料:在离线状态下,无法通过搜索引擎查找文档和参考资料。因此,需要提前下载相应的离线文档和参考资料。许多编程语言和框架都提供了离线文档下载的选项,可以在离线状态下方便地查阅文档。

    二、编写和测试代码

    1. 创建新项目或打开已有项目:在离线状态下,可以使用代码编辑器创建新的项目或打开已有的项目。
    2. 编写代码:开始编写代码,实现所需的功能。可以使用代码编辑器的代码补全、语法高亮等功能来提高效率。
    3. 运行本地测试:在离线状态下,可以运行本地测试来验证代码的正确性。可以使用相应的工具或框架来进行单元测试、集成测试等。

    三、版本控制和团队协作

    1. 使用本地版本控制系统:在离线状态下,可以使用本地的版本控制系统来管理代码的历史记录和版本管理。例如,可以使用Git进行版本控制,在离线状态下可以进行提交、分支管理等操作。
    2. 合并和解决冲突:如果在离线状态下进行代码修改,后来又有其他人在联网状态下对同一文件进行了修改,那么在联网前需要解决冲突。可以使用版本控制系统提供的工具来合并代码和解决冲突。

    四、其他工作

    1. 整理和备份代码:在离线状态下可以进行代码的整理和备份工作。可以使用代码编辑器的功能来对代码进行格式化、重构等操作,同时备份代码到本地或其他设备上。
    2. 学习和阅读文档:离线状态下,可以利用下载的离线文档和参考资料进行学习和阅读。可以深入研究特定主题,查找问题的解决方案等。

    总结:编程离线状态下,可以利用已安装的开发环境和工具,编写和测试代码。同时,可以使用本地版本控制系统进行代码管理和团队协作。此外,还可以进行其他工作,如整理和备份代码,学习和阅读文档等。在离线状态下,需要提前准备好离线工具和资源,以便能够顺利进行编程工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部